Product Details

Our throw pillows are made from 100% spun polyester poplin fabric and add a stylish statement to any room. Pillows are available in sizes from 14" x 14" up to 26" x 26". Each pillow is printed on both sides (same image) and includes a concealed zipper and removable insert (if selected) for easy cleaning.

About Carol Grimes

Carol Grimes

I am a self taught artist. I was born in Portland, Oregon. I can remember my art teacher in high school she was so inspiring for me, she made me want to make my living doing nothing but art work, Back then I studied dress design. I wanted to draw those beautiful fashion drawing that used to be in the paper, back in the sixties. Then my love turned to drawing horses, I couldn't get enough of drawing horses. Then I realized that I had to be a wife, and mother of 2 children, and that took a whole lot of my spare time. The years went by but my love for art never faded, Since my retirement I have spent some wonderful hours doing what makes me so happy. Now my hours are filled with ART. And now in 2013.
